Condition: new, functionality: fully functional, power: 75 kW (101.97 HP), Year of construction: 2025, Impact Crusher: Structure, Operation, and Technical Specifications
An impact crusher is a high-efficiency crushing machine widely used in mining, cement, construction, and recycling industries. It is designed to crush materials by utilizing the energy of impact rather than pressure, making it ideal for medium-hard and soft materials such as limestone, gypsum, coal, and concrete aggregates. Its ability to produce uniform, cubic-shaped particles makes it a preferred choice for aggregate production and fine crushing applications.
Working Principle
The impact crusher operates on a simple yet powerful principle: material is fed into the crushing chamber and struck by high-speed rotating blow bars mounted on a rotor. The kinetic energy from the rotor transfers to the material, causing it to break upon collision with the impact plates (also known as breaker plates). The crushed material rebounds within the chamber for secondary impacts until it reaches the desired size and exits through the discharge opening.
The process involves:
Primary Impact: Material is hit by blow bars and thrown against the impact plates.
Secondary Impact: Rebounded fragments collide again with the rotor or other particles, achieving finer crushing and better shape.
Structural Composition
An impact crusher consists of several key components that ensure efficient operation and durability:
Rotor Assembly: The core component, equipped with blow bars that deliver high-speed impact energy.
Impact Plates (Aprons): Adjustable plates that control the crushing gap and final product size.
Feed Inlet and Discharge Outlet: Designed for smooth material flow and uniform discharge.
Frame and Housing: Heavy-duty welded structure providing stability and vibration resistance.
Adjusting Device: Hydraulic or mechanical system for controlling the gap between rotor and impact plates.
Safety Mechanism: Hydraulic opening system for easy maintenance and overload protection.
Technical Highlights
Feed size: ≤500 mm
Discharge size: 0–60 mm (adjustable)
Klodpfx Agev E Ddlsnst
Capacity: 30–800 t/h
Motor power: 45–560 kW
Rotor speed: 500–1500 rpm
Performance Features:
High Crushing Efficiency: The high-speed rotor and optimized chamber design ensure strong impact force and high reduction ratio.
Excellent Particle Shape: Produces cubic, uniform aggregates suitable for concrete and asphalt production.
Adjustable Output Size: Hydraulic or mechanical adjustment allows precise control of product size.
Easy Maintenance: Replaceable blow bars and liners with quick access doors simplify servicing.
Versatile Applications: Suitable for primary, secondary, and tertiary crushing in various industries.
Types of Impact Crushers
Horizontal Shaft Impact (HSI) Crusher:
Uses a horizontal rotor to deliver impact energy. Ideal for soft to medium-hard materials and widely used in aggregate and recycling applications.
Conclusion
The impact crusher combines high-speed impact energy with a robust structural design to deliver efficient, reliable, and versatile crushing performance. Its ability to produce well-shaped aggregates, adjustable output sizes, and low maintenance requirements make it indispensable in modern crushing systems. Whether in mining, construction, or recycling, the impact crusher remains a key machine for achieving high productivity and superior material quality.

Condition: new, functionality: fully functional, power: 11 kW (14.96 HP), Year of construction: 2025, A spiral-type sand washer machine, also known as a spiral sand washing machine or screw sand washer, is a piece of equipment designed for washing, classifying, and dewatering sand and other granular materials. This type of sand washer typically features a spiral or screw-shaped structure for the purpose of lifting, conveying, and washing materials.
Here are key features and aspects of a spiral-type sand washer machine:
1. Spiral Structure: The core component of the machine is a spiral or screw-shaped structure, often enclosed within a tub or trough. This spiral impeller is responsible for lifting, conveying, and washing the sand as it rotates.
2. Tub or Trough Design: The spiral structure is usually housed within a tub or trough that holds the water and sand mixture. This design allows for efficient washing and separation of impurities from the sand.
3. Multiple Blades: The spiral impeller typically has multiple blades or flights that provide mechanical agitation to the sand, ensuring thorough cleaning.
4. Water Injection: Water is injected into the tub or trough to aid in the washing process. The combination of water and the rotating spiral helps to remove impurities from the sand.
5. Adjustable Weirs: Some spiral-type sand washers have adjustable weirs or gates that control the flow of water and the retention time of the sand in the machine, allowing for customization of the washing process.
6. Classification and Dewatering: Spiral sand washers often include features for classifying and dewatering the sand. This may involve the use of a separate compartment or mechanism for fine sand recovery and water drainage.
7. Variable Speed: The rotational speed of the spiral can often be adjusted to optimize the washing process for different types of materials and particle sizes.
Kledpfxsq Nf S Rs Agnjt
8. Capacity: The capacity of a spiral-type sand washer is influenced by factors such as the size of the machine, the pitch of the spiral, and the efficiency of the washing process. Different models are available to suit various production requirements.
9. Materials Handling: Spiral sand washers are commonly used in applications such as aggregate processing, mining, concrete production, and other industries where the removal of impurities from sand is essential.
10. Ease of Maintenance: Many spiral-type sand washers are designed for easy maintenance, with accessible components and inspection points.
Spiral-type sand washer machines are efficient tools for cleaning and processing sand, ensuring that the final product meets quality standards for use in construction, concrete production, and other applications. The specific features and capabilities of these machines can vary between different models and manufacturers.

Condition: new, functionality: fully functional, Year of construction: 2025, Aggregate and ballast crusher equipment are used in the crushing and processing of various materials for construction and infrastructure projects. These crushers are designed to break down large rocks, gravel, or stones into smaller pieces, producing aggregates and ballast that are essential components in the construction industry. Here are some key aspects related to aggregate and ballast crusher equipment:
1. Jaw Crusher:
- Jaw crushers are commonly used for primary crushing in aggregate and ballast production. They operate by compressing the material between a stationary and a movable jaw.
2. Impact Crusher:
- Impact crushers are suitable for shaping and producing fine aggregates. They use impact force to crush the material, making them suitable for various types of rock and ore.
3. Cone Crusher:
- Cone crushers are often used for secondary and tertiary crushing in aggregate production. They are efficient for producing well-shaped and finely graded aggregates.
4. Vertical Shaft Impact (VSI) Crusher:
- VSI crushers are designed for shaping and producing high-quality artificial sand. They use the "rock-on-rock" crushing principle, where rocks are fed into the rotor to be accelerated and crushed against the stationary anvils.
5. Gyratory Crusher:
- Gyratory crushers are primarily used in mining, but they may also be used in the production of aggregates. They have a conical head and a concave surface, which crushes the material between the head and concave.
6. Mobile Crushers:
- Mobile crushers, including mobile jaw crushers and mobile impact crushers, provide flexibility and mobility for on-site crushing of aggregates and ballast. They are often used in construction projects where materials need to be processed directly at the job site.
7. Screens and Scalpers:
- Screens and scalpers are used to separate different sizes of aggregates after the initial crushing stage. Vibrating screens are commonly employed to classify and separate materials based on size.
8. Conveyors:
- Conveyors are crucial for transporting materials between various stages of the crushing process and for stockpiling the final products. They enhance efficiency in material handling.
9. Dust Suppression Systems:
- Crushing operations can generate dust, and dust suppression systems are used to minimize environmental and health impacts. These systems may include water sprays or chemical suppressants.
10. Quality Control:
- Quality control measures, such as particle size analysis and gradation testing, are essential to ensure that the produced aggregates and ballast meet the required specifications and standards.
Kedpeq Nxrxefx Agnolt
11. Environmental Considerations:
- Crusher equipment should adhere to environmental regulations, and measures like dust control, noise reduction, and proper waste disposal should be implemented.
When selecting aggregate and ballast crusher equipment, factors such as the type of material, required product size, production capacity, and mobility requirements should be taken into consideration. Additionally, adherence to safety and environmental standards is crucial in the operation of crushing equipment.

Condition: new, functionality: fully functional, Year of construction: 2025, A double teeth roller crusher is a type of roller crusher commonly used in industries that involve the crushing of various materials, such as mining, metallurgy, building materials, and chemical processing. This crusher is characterized by its two pairs of closely spaced, parallel, and oppositely rotating rolls with "teeth" or "knurling" on their surfaces. The teeth are designed to grab and crush the material, providing efficient and uniform size reduction.
Here are key features and aspects of double teeth roller crusher equipment:
1. Double Roller Design:
Ksdpfx Asq Nga Ujgnslt
- The crusher features two parallel, counter-rotating rollers, each with a set of teeth or knurling on its surface. The dual roller design facilitates a consistent and efficient crushing process.
2. Teeth Configuration:
- The teeth on the rollers are designed to grip and crush the material. The arrangement and shape of the teeth may vary based on the specific application and the characteristics of the material being processed.
3. Adjustable Gap Settings:
- The gap between the rollers can usually be adjusted to control the size of the crushed particles. This feature allows for customization of the final product size.
4. Material Feed and Discharge:
- Material is typically fed into the top of the crusher and is crushed between the rotating rollers. The crushed material is discharged at the bottom of the machine.
5. High Efficiency:
- Double teeth roller crushers are known for their high efficiency in crushing various materials. The dual roller design provides a more consistent and controlled process compared to single roller crushers.
6. Versatility:
- These crushers are versatile and can be used for various materials, including coal, limestone, slag, clay, and other similar materials.
7. Application in Mining and Processing:
- Double teeth roller crushers are commonly used in the mining industry for the crushing of minerals and ores. They are also utilized in other industries for size reduction and processing of materials.
8. Dust and Noise Control:
- Some double teeth roller crushers are equipped with features to control dust emissions and reduce noise during operation, improving the working environment.
9. High Torque and Power:
- A powerful motor and a robust drive system are essential components to drive the rotation of the rollers, providing the necessary torque and power for efficient crushing.
10. Maintenance and Safety:
- Regular maintenance is essential for optimal performance. Safety features, such as emergency stops and safety guards, are often incorporated to ensure safe operation.
11. Application in Size Reduction:
- Double teeth roller crushers are effective in size reduction and are suitable for applications where precise control over the final product size is crucial.
It's important to note that the specific design, features, and applications of double teeth roller crushers can vary among different models and manufacturers. When selecting or using this type of equipment, it's advisable to refer to the manufacturer's guidelines and specifications for proper operation and maintenance.

Condition: new, Year of construction: 2025, A sand aggregate production plant is a facility where various types of aggregates (such as sand, gravel, crushed stone, or recycled concrete) are produced for use in construction and other applications. These plants typically include various stages of processing, from raw material extraction to the final product.
Here are the key components and processes typically involved in a sand aggregate production plant:
1. Raw Material Extraction:
Klodpoq Ngb Dofx Agnot
- Quarrying or Mining: Aggregates are often extracted from quarries, mines, or riverbeds. Depending on the type of aggregate, the extraction process may involve drilling, blasting, or dredging.
2. Primary Crushing:
- Jaw Crusher or Gyratory Crusher: The extracted raw material is usually transported to the plant and fed into a primary crusher, where large rocks are broken down into smaller pieces.
3. Secondary Crushing:
- Cone Crusher or Impact Crusher: The crushed material from the primary crusher may undergo further reduction in size through secondary crushing.
4. Screening:
- Vibrating Screens: After crushing, the material is often screened to separate different sizes of aggregates. This process ensures that the final product meets the required specifications.
5. Washing:
- Sand Washers: In some cases, especially for sand production, washing is done to remove impurities, clay, and fines from the aggregates, ensuring a cleaner and higher-quality product.
6. Grading and Sorting:
- Classifiers or Graders: After washing and screening, the aggregates may go through additional processes to separate them based on size or quality.
7. Stockpiling:
- Stockpiles: The final aggregates are usually stockpiled for storage before being transported to construction sites or other end-users.
8. Aggregate Storage and Handling:
- Storage Bins or Silos: Larger production plants may have storage facilities, such as bins or silos, to store different types and sizes of aggregates before distribution.
9. Quality Control:
- Laboratory Testing: Regular quality control testing is performed on aggregates to ensure they meet specifications for strength, size, gradation, and other properties.
10. Environmental Considerations:
- Water Management: Some plants incorporate water management systems to recycle and reuse water used in the washing process, minimizing environmental impact.
11. Transportation:
- Conveyors or Trucks: Aggregates are typically transported from the production plant to construction sites by conveyors, trucks, or other means.
